Abstract(in English) Splicing systems are mathematical models for chemical reactions of DNA sequences, that were introduced by Head in 1987. Although a splicing system specifies a regular language, it is known that there is a regular language which can not be generated by any splicing system. Symbolic dynamical systems are sets of infinite sequences which are closely related to formal languages. In this manuscript several characterizations of the splicing system are given by using the theory of symbolic dynamical system.
